Our Sliding & Patio Doors Services in Half Moon Bay

We install, replace, and service the full range of sliding and patio door systems in Half Moon Bay. Here’s what we handle most often, and what matters for each type on this particular coast.

Patio Sliding Doors

The standard workhorse of Half Moon Bay patios and deck access points. We replace old aluminum sliders that have seized up with new vinyl or fiberglass-frame units. On west-facing homes near the bluffs, we strongly recommend fiberglass frames with stainless steel rollers, because the salt air is relentless and a vinyl frame with galv hardware won’t give you the service life you paid for. Standard patio slider replacement runs $2,800-$6,500 depending on size and glass package.

Panoramic Sliding Systems

For homeowners who want the entire wall to open. Multi-panel and lift-and-slide systems with panels up to 8 feet wide. These are the most expensive and the most sensitive to installation tolerances. Along the open coast, we specify marine-anodized aluminum or fiberglass, not standard powder-coat. A panoramic system in Half Moon Bay runs $7,500-$18,000 installed, and we register both warranty layers in writing before we leave.

Heavy-Duty Sliding Doors

When we say heavy-duty in Half Moon Bay, we mean it has to survive wind gusts off the Pacific and daily salt mist. These are reinforced frames, heavier glass, and stainless or anodized tracks built for exposed exterior openings. We install heavy-duty sliders on bluff-top properties from Surfer’s Beach to Ocean Colony where builders originally hung standard doors that were never spec’d for this exposure. Typical range: $4,500-$9,500 installed.

Pocket & Barn Doors

Interior pocket and barn door systems are still subject to Half Moon Bay’s humidity cycling, though they aren’t exposed to salt. Warped framing, swollen jambs, and door panels that stick in July then rattle in January are common in older beach cottages along Stone Pine Road and surrounding areas. We true the framing, repair or replace the slab, and set the hardware so it slides without racking. Repair calls for pocket doors in Half Moon Bay typically run $450-$1,400. Full replacement is $1,800-$4,000 depending on the opening and door spec.

Screen Door Installation

Salt air doesn’t care whether it’s a $15,000 panoramic slider or a $400 screen door. Standard aluminum screen frames pit white within two or three seasons here. We custom-build screen doors with anodized frames and marine-grade mesh that doesn’t corrode or sag. Replacement screens for existing sliding doors in Half Moon Bay run $180-$520, and new custom screen doors run $450-$1,100 installed.

Common Sliding & Patio Doors Problems We See in Half Moon Bay Homes

  • Seized or corroded tracks. Salt-laden marine air attacks standard aluminum rollers and locking hardware. In Half Moon Bay, sliding doors often bind or jam within three to five seasons, especially on west-facing elevations.
  • Swollen, sticking wood sashes. Fog-driven moisture cycles cause wood-framed patio doors to swell and stick seasonally. Doors that close fine in October stick hard in June when the marine layer sits on the house.
  • Failed glazing seals and fogged glass. The daily humidity swings and salt particulate on the glass put unusual stress on double-pane seals. Fogged glass is the most common cosmetic failure we get called for in Half Moon Bay.
  • Rotted sub-sills behind stucco or siding. Poorly flashed patio door installations wick fog moisture into the rough opening. By the time the homeowner sees staining on interior trim, rot has usually attacked the sub-sill and framing.

Pricing for Sliding & Patio Doors in Half Moon Bay, CA

Half Moon Bay pricing runs above inland Bay Area rates for one reason: coastal exposure. A standard 6-foot vinyl patio slider that might cost $1,800 in San Mateo runs $2,800-$5,000 here when properly spec’d for salt air. Fiberglass frames, marine-anodized aluminum, stainless hardware, and upgraded flashing all add material cost up front, but they are not optional on the open Pacific side. A cheap inland-spec installation in Half Moon Bay often fails within five to seven years, and the second replacement always costs more than the coastal-spec would have on day one.
